West Fulton, NY Radon Mitigation and Testing
Found in Schoharie County within the Albany Metro region, West Fulton sits in the Mohawk Valley where sedimentary bedrock and glacial deposits create varied radon potential. Radon testing data for zip code 12194 is currently unavailable, making professional assessment crucial for area homeowners. The region's geological setting and typical foundation styles warrant individual testing to determine radon risk levels.

West Fulton Radon Facts
Key details about the radon risk profile for West Fulton and the 12194 zip code area.
West Fulton and the 12194 zip code are located in Schoharie County, which has an EPA assigned Radon Zone of 1. A radon zone of 1 predicts an average indoor radon screening level greater than 4 pCi/L. The EPA recommends testing every home regardless of zone classification.
